Assistant Producer (Religious Programming Department) – Islam Channel Limited

About the Role

The Assistant Producer is responsible for developing and producing high-quality, original content—including programmes, series, and podcasts across religious, current affairs & news, lifestyle, factual, and documentary genres—for a global Muslim audience.

Reporting to: Head of Religious Programming

Key Responsibilities

Content Development & Production

  • Work with the team to develop and produce high-quality, original content from concept to completion across platforms
  • Ensure projects align with Islam Channel’s vision, budget, and timeline
  • Lead the development phase, including:
    • Conducting research
    • Writing treatments and scripts
    • Pitching ideas and securing suitable guests, presenters, or panellists
    • Managing correspondence via email, phone, or social media

Pre-Production & Management

  • Organise kick-off meetings with stakeholders and brief teams/crew before shoots
  • Manage departmental teams (if applicable) while offering mentorship to volunteers, interns, graduates, and researchers
  • Coordinate social media content (e.g., current affairs posts for Islam Channel)
  • Plan and execute location shoots, ensuring production requirements are met

Technical & Creative Contributions

-Preferably able to present religious shows on camera -Advantage to be able to self-film and edit -Ensure high-quality audio, lighting, and visuals during filming

Operational & Legal Compliance

  • Oversee shoots in studio or remote locations, troubleshooting issues as needed
  • Ensure conformity with Ofcom guidelines and editorial policies
  • Maintain safety compliance by conducting risk assessments, enforcing health & safety protocols, and completing approvals
  • Manage direct reports, approve invoices, and budgets while adherence to company approval processes

Required Qualifications & Experience

  • Bachelor's degree in a religious, media, or broadcast-related subject (essential)
  • Minimum 3+ years of experience in broadcast production with a proven record of:
    • Creating high-quality original programming
    • Experiencing religion-specific content production
  • Fluency with Adobe Creative Suite, particularly Premiere Pro and After Effects

Desired Skills & Knowledge

  • Advanced knowledge of Islamic principles and methodologies for engaging storytelling
  • Ability to manage complex productions with stakeholders, multiple teams, and freelancers
  • Strong verbal and written communication skills required
  • Proficiency in project planning and budget management
  • Ability to film with DSLR cameras (high asset)
  • Experience in on-camera presentation (advantageous)
  • Practical fieldwork experience in filming production

Company Notes

  • Full-time: 40 hours/week, Monday–Friday (with flexible availability for weekends and bank holidays)
  • Location: Head Office, London (IG2 7BS)
  • Salary: Competitive based on skill, experience, and qualifications
